The hotel's signature feature is its direct lake access, offering guests a private beach area and a pool right on the water, providing stunning views of the lake and surrounding mountains. This makes it an ideal destination for couples seeking a romantic getaway, families looking for recreational activities, and relaxation seekers desiring a tranquil escape. The property is also well-suited for sightseers, hikers, and cyclists due to its excellent location for exploring the region. Guests consistently highlight the exceptionally friendly staff and the excellent breakfast as key aspects of their stay. While the hotel is praised for its charming outdoor areas, many reviews note that the building itself is aged and could benefit from renovations. To enhance your experience, it is advisable to request a room with a lake view, as rooms facing the road can be noisy, and be sure to take full advantage of the unique lake access.
Facilities & Amenities
The hotel offers a range of facilities designed to enhance the guest experience, though some areas show signs of age. A significant highlight is the outdoor pool area, which provides ample sun loungers and direct access to the lake, allowing guests to swim in the Schliersee. While the pool area is generally appreciated, some guests noted that the pool water can be cold, and certain elements of the outdoor space appear dated. The wellness area, including a sauna, receives mixed feedback, with some guests finding it unloved or in need of maintenance, citing issues like defective showers. The elevator is available, but some reviews describe it as aged and small, potentially challenging for guests with mobility needs. The minibar in rooms is mentioned, though some guests reported issues with its functionality or lack of complimentary water. Parking is available on-site, with some guests finding it convenient, while others experienced limited availability, especially during peak times, necessitating parking further away.
Cleanliness & Room Comfort
Guest feedback on room comfort and cleanliness is varied, often reflecting the hotel's age. While some guests found their rooms to be spacious, clean, and even modernized with beautiful lake views, others described them as small, dark, or significantly aged, mentioning issues like water damage and worn carpeting. The beds receive mixed reviews; some found them comfortable with good mattresses, while others reported them as too soft, sagging, or having uncomfortable pillows, occasionally noting the beds were too small. A recurring concern is noise levels, particularly for rooms facing the busy main road, making it difficult to sleep with windows open, especially in the absence of air conditioning. Bathrooms are also a point of contention; some are described as spacious, but others had issues with defective fittings, mould, lack of storage space for toiletries, or water leakage from the shower, with some fixtures being unusually high.
Dining & Food Quality
The hotel's dining options consistently receive high praise from guests. The breakfast buffet is frequently highlighted as a standout feature, described as "excellent," "very good," "rich," and "varied," offering a wide selection of fresh items that cater to diverse tastes. Guests appreciate that everything is promptly refilled, ensuring a satisfying start to the day. The restaurant also garners positive comments for its delicious food, with many enjoying the traditional Bavarian cuisine and generous portion sizes. However, some guests found the restaurant's atmosphere less inviting or perceived the food as overpriced. A particularly popular feature is the beer garden, which is lauded for its beautiful setting directly by the lake, its pleasant atmosphere, and its delicious food and drink offerings. It is often cited as a perfect spot to relax and enjoy a meal with scenic views, contributing significantly to the overall positive dining experience.
Location & Accessibility
The hotel's location is a major draw, situated directly on the Schliersee with stunning views and immediate access to the water, making it an ideal base for various activities. Guests appreciate its proximity to the lake, which allows for swimming and enjoying the natural surroundings. The area is also highly recommended for hiking and cycling, with numerous trails and scenic routes nearby. While the direct lakefront position is a significant advantage, the hotel's proximity to a busy main road is a frequent point of concern, leading to considerable noise, especially for rooms facing that direction or when windows are open. For accessibility, a bus stop is conveniently located nearby, and some guests noted that a guest card can provide free bus usage, facilitating exploration of the wider region. Parking availability on-site can be limited, particularly during peak seasons, sometimes requiring guests to seek alternative parking solutions.
Staff & Service
The staff and service at the hotel consistently receive overwhelmingly positive feedback from guests. Reviewers frequently describe the team as exceptionally friendly, helpful, attentive, and polite, contributing significantly to a welcoming and pleasant atmosphere. Many guests felt a strong sense of personal connection and even a "family-like" ambiance during their stay, highlighting the staff's dedication to making guests feel at home. The check-in process is generally reported as quick and efficient, often accompanied by a welcoming drink. While the hotel is noted for its pet-friendly service, allowing guests to bring their dogs, some pet owners found the designated breakfast area for dogs to be stuffy and noted a lack of specific amenities like water bowls or waste bags. Overall, the staff's commitment to excellent service is a recurring theme, enhancing the guest experience despite other potential shortcomings of the property.
